~Viper: prior post about the over seas lack of effectiveness when trying for service. So I tried to call Sears corporate, customer relations. The number that I got off the internet lands you with the corporate operator, or at least that is what they said. I asked for customer relations and was immediately put back on the over seas line. I called back and told them I wanted to speak to customer relations in Chicago and was immediately put back on the overseas line. Tried to call back a third and fourth time and the number did not answer (I think they blocked my number ) so I used another phone and it answered and I told the lady that I was wanting to speak to someone local she said, "LOOK! If you have a complaint you go overseas, GET IT?" then she hung up on me. I was never loud or rude in any way. So if this is the kind of help that is present at Corporate it pretty much tells you what the Corporate culture is. I am thankful I sold my Sears stock years years ago as I fear the long term progno
